Key Drivers and Market Dynamics
Major drivers include the growing incidence of autoimmune diseases such as rheumatoid arthritis, Crohn’s disease, and psoriasis, which require immunosuppressive therapy. The rising number of organ transplant procedures worldwide and improved surgical outcomes are also boosting demand. Additionally, the introduction of biosimilars and generic drugs is increasing accessibility and affordability, while innovations in targeted formulations and nanotechnology-based delivery systems enhance efficacy and patient outcomes.
Segmentation and Regional Insights
- Dosage Form: Ophthalmic Solutions (37.2% share in 2024), Injectable Solutions (32.1%), Capsules, Topical Creams, Eye Drops (30.7%)
- Application: Organ Transplantation (largest share, projected USD 4.02 billion by 2032), Rheumatic Diseases (USD 2.57 billion by 2032), Ocular Surface Diseases, Nephrotic Syndrome, Uveitis
- Route of Administration: Oral (largest share in 2024), Ocular, Intravenous, Topical
- Distribution Channels: Hospital Pharmacies (dominant), Retail Pharmacies, Online Pharmacies
Regionally, North America and Europe dominate due to advanced healthcare infrastructure, while Asia Pacific, South America, and the Middle East & Africa are emerging markets driven by increasing healthcare access and rising transplant procedures.
